导航
当前位置:首页>>app
在线生成app,封装app

苹果上架二进制文件被拒绝怎么办?

2024-11-12 围观 : 0次

在苹果App Store上架二进制文件时,开发者可能会遇到拒绝的情况。这种情况通常是因为开发者尝试在应用程序包中包含二进制文件,而这些文件可能会导致应用程序无法通过审核。在本文中,我们将详细介绍苹果上架二进制文件被拒绝的原因和解决方法。

首先,我们需要了解什么是二进制文件。简单来说,二进制文件是一种计算机文件,包含机器语言指令和数据,用于执行特定的计算机任务。在应用程序开发中,开发者可以使用二进制文件来实现一些特定的功能,例如加密、解密、压缩等。但是,苹果不允许开发者在应用程序包中包含任何未经授权的二进制文件。

苹果上架二进制文件被拒绝的原因主要有以下几点

1. 安全问题苹果认为,包含未经授权的二进制文件可能会导致安全问题。这些文件可能包含恶意代码,会影响用户的隐私和数据安全。

2. 版权问题开发者可能会使用未经授权的二进制文件,侵犯他人的版权和知识产权。这可能会导致法律问题和经济损失。

3. 代码质量问题苹果要求应用程序必须符合一定的代码质量标准。包含未经授权的二进制文件可能会导致代码质量问题,从而影响应用程序的性能和稳定性。

解决苹果上架二进制文件被拒绝的问题,开发者可以采取以下几个步骤

1. 检查应用程序包开发者需要仔细检查应用程序包,确保其中不包含任何未经授权的

二进制文件。如果发现了问题,需要及时删除这些文件。

2. 使用可信的第三方库如果应用程序需要使用一些特定的功能,开发者可以选择使用可信的第三方库。这些库通常已经经过苹果的审核,可以保证安全性和稳定性。

3. 优化代码质量开发者需要优化应用程序的代码质量,确保应用程序符合苹果的要求。这包括遵循苹果的编码规范、使用最佳实践等。

总之,苹果上架二进制文件被拒绝是一个常见的问题,但是开发者可以通过仔细检查应用程序包、使用可信的第三方库、优化代码质量等措施来解决这个问题。只有符合苹果的要求,才能保证应用程序的安全性和稳定性,获得用户的信任和好评。

相关文章
  • eclipse开发app插件

    Eclipse是一个广泛使用的Java集成开发环境(IDE),它提供了许多功能强大的插件,使开发人员能够轻松扩展和定制自己的开发环境。在本文中,我将为您介绍如何开发一个Eclipse插件,并深入了解其原理和详细操作。1. 插件的基本结构在Eclipse中,插件采用一种基于OSGi的...

    2024-03-29
  • 使用h5开发app怎么做

    HTML5开发的一个优点是能够轻松地将现有的web应用移植到移动端。HTML5不仅具有Web应用所需的HTML、CSS、JS技术,还添加了本地存储、地理位置服务、离线应用等特性。因此,使用HTML5开发APP可以得到与本地应用相同的功能和交互性。下面是基于HTML5开发APP的原理和详细介绍:一、概...

    2023-11-25
  • 新闻安卓app开发,新闻聚合类app开发

    00-1010 1.红板报 红板报是全球新闻聚合应用软件Flipboard中文app,聚合深度文章、资讯和优质媒体。全球热点触手可及,你可以享受一个简单、美好、有创意的阅读和讨论空间。 功能介绍: 聚合优质媒体,带来...

    2023-12-30
  • ios怎么更改实名,ios怎么更改实名认证信息

    怎么改实名认证? 打开微信app,点击下方的“我”。点击下方的“我”后,再点击上方的支付进入支付界面。点击右上角三点进入支付管理。点击【实名认证】选项。打开微信,点击“我”,选择“支付”,进入页面。点击右上角的三点图标。在“支付管理”页面中选择“实名认证”。滑至底部,点击“更换实名”。在实名认证过程...

    2024-01-07
  • 怎么更改安卓应用签名

    更改Android应用签名是一种修改应用的数字证书的过程,它可以用于跳过应用程序验证、修改应用程序的权限、更改应用程序的发布者等目的。但需要注意的是,这样做可能会违反应用开发者的使用条款,并且可能对应用的功能和安全性产生负面影响。下面是一种常见的更改Android应用签名的方法:步...

    2024-11-04